Item 5.02 Departure of Directors or Certain Officers; Election of Directors; Appointment of Certain Officers; Compensatory Arrangements of Certain Officers.

Resignation of Mr. Ruberg

On January 23, 2011, David C. Ruberg resigned as a director of Broadview Networks Holdings, Inc. (the “Company”), effective as of January 24, 2011. Mr. Ruberg indicated that he has no disputes regarding the Company’s operations, policies or practices. Until his resignation, Mr. Ruberg served on an ad hoc compensation committee established by the Company’s Board of Directors (the “Board”).

Appointment of Ms. Ford

Pursuant to the Third Amended and Restated Shareholders Agreement, by and among the Company and the shareholders named therein, dated as of May 31, 2007 (as amended, modified or supplemented from time to time, the “ Shareholders Agreement”), which provides Baker Communications Fund, L.P. and Baker Communications Fund II (QP), L.P. (collectively, “Baker”) the right to designate two persons to serve on the Board, Baker has elected to designate Kerri Ford to serve on the Board and it is expected that Ms. Ford will be elected at the next meeting of the Board. Ms. Ford is not expected to serve on any committee of the Board at this time.

Ms. Ford joined Baker in 2003. Prior to joining Baker, Ms. Ford was an investment banker at Goldman Sachs Group, Inc., advising both public and private companies. Previously, she held several positions at Cabletron Systems, a publicly traded computer networking hardware and enterprise management software company that is now a privately held company known as Enterasys Networks, Inc., where she was involved in international financial management, government contracting and other operational roles. Ms. Ford currently serves on the board of directors of MediaNet Digital, Inc. Ms. Ford earned a Masters in Business Administration from The Wharton School at the University of Pennsylvania and a Bachelor of Science from the University of New Hampshire.

Since the beginning of the Company’s last fiscal year, there has been no transaction or any currently proposed transaction in which the Company was or is to be a participant and the amount involved exceeds $120,000 and in which Ms. Ford has or will have a direct or indirect material interest.
